PRESCHOOL ENGLISH courses start with one weekly session of one hour, although the recommended time at this stage is 2 hours per week, divided into two sessions of 1 hour each on alternate days.
The two main activities carried out at this stage are:
– Academic English
– Lego Planet in English
Academic English is taught using CAMBRIDGE ENGLISH workbooks, with which children learn vocabulary and small expressions that they repeat in each class as part of activities and games, gradually expanding their knowledge over the months.
At the end of the course, it becomes visible how their English has developed, and the child appears much more confident and motivated to continue learning. These sessions include projects that complement learning, especially in the more immersive part. One of these is the MyPet project.
On the other hand, the activity LEGO PLANET IN ENGLISH is recognized as one of the most effective at this stage and has multiple benefits for the child, ranging from immersive and repetitive learning to the expression of abstract thinking and creativity.
NOVACADÈMIA has analyzed the psychopedagogical benefits of the activity with the guidance of Anaïs Rodríguez, psychologist and educational psychologist (licensed 24228).
The main benefits are:
- It fosters creativity and cognitive flexibility, thus helping to simultaneously develop the ability to solve different problems that may arise.
- It helps to establish logical relationships and plan actions more effectively, enhancing multiple skills related to logical reasoning.
- It improves fine motor skills and visuo-constructive, visuo-perceptive, and visuo-spatial abilities.
- It promotes self-concept and social skills.
- It allows the creation of an optimal environment for cooperative work and enhances communication among children.
In this sense, being able to carry out the activity in English provides the added benefit of language exposure, allowing children to work on all these aspects while also beginning to use and understand vocabulary related to the activity in a language other than their mother tongue. At the same time, it allows them to associate the language with a moment of fun and confidence.
The combination of both activities is a perfect routine for children between 3 and 5 years old, and their results are proven.
Children begin using the language by combining basic technical aspects adapted to their age, while also learning the different phonemes and sounds of the language through games, projects, and the most innovative official materials designed and published by CAMBRIDGE UNIVERSITY PRESS.
